The Benefits of Electric Cars for Seniors
Comfort and Ease of Use
Seniors typically seek vehicles that are not only reliable but also comfortable and easy to operate. Electric cars meet these requirements perfectly. Their smooth acceleration, silent running, and straightforward controls make for a pleasant driving experience. Features such as automatic transmissions and intuitive dashboard displays further enhance ease of use, reducing the cognitive burden on senior drivers.
Affordability and Savings
One of the most appealing aspects of electric cars is their lower maintenance costs compared to traditional gasoline vehicles. Routine services like oil changes, engine tune-ups, and exhaust system repairs are virtually eliminated, saving both time and money. Additionally, the cost per mile for electric vehicles (EVs) is significantly lower, providing long-term financial benefits. For cost-conscious seniors, these savings make EVs an attractive option.

Top Electric Cars for Seniors Under $30,000
Nissan Leaf
The Nissan Leaf is one of the most popular and affordable options for seniors entering the electric car market. Priced around $28,000, it provides an excellent range of features for the price, including driver assistance technologies and a user-friendly infotainment system. The Leaf offers a range of up to 150 miles per charge, making it suitable for daily errands and outings.
Chevrolet Bolt EV
The Chevrolet Bolt EV is another viable option for seniors, renowned for its excellent range of about 259 miles and a starting price under $30,000. Its compact size makes parking and maneuvering easier, a practical feature for older drivers. The Bolt is equipped with advanced safety features like lane-keeping assist and forward collision alert, offering peace of mind on the road.
Hyundai Kona Electric
The Hyundai Kona Electric brings together versatility and affordability. With only a slightly higher starting price in the range of $30,000 (before incentives), it offers a compelling value. The Kona features a robust range of 258 miles, spacious interiors, and advanced technology features, making it a standout choice for senior drivers.
Factors to Consider When Choosing an Electric Car
Range and Charging Options
When selecting an electric car, range and charging infrastructure are critical considerations for seniors. It's important to evaluate driving habits and ensure access to convenient charging stations, both at home and on common routes. Manufacturers are rapidly expanding charging networks, making owning an EV increasingly practical.
Tech Features and Safety
Safety is a top priority for many seniors, and electric cars tend to come equipped with a range of driver assistance features. From blind-spot monitoring to emergency braking systems, these technologies can greatly enhance safety. Tech-savvy seniors might also appreciate features like smartphone connectivity and advanced navigation systems.
Comfort and Accessibility
For seniors, comfort and accessibility are paramount. It’s important to choose a car with easily adjustable seats, ample headroom, and wide door openings to facilitate comfortable entry and exit. Many electric models also offer customizable seating positions to accommodate various physical needs.
